Choosing the Right Auto One Service in Lancaster
With numerous auto repair shops in Lancaster, choosing the right one can feel overwhelming. Consider factors like certifications, customer reviews, and specialization. auto one service center lancaster pa provides a valuable resource for finding qualified mechanics in your area. Look for shops with ASE-certified technicians, which indicates a commitment to quality and expertise.
What to Look for in a Reputable Auto Repair Shop
- ASE Certification
- Positive Customer Reviews
- Specialization (e.g., European cars, diesel engines)
- Warranty Information
- Clear Communication

Tips for Choosing Quality Auto Parts
- Opt for O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ts whenever possible.
- Research reputable aftermarket brands.
- Ask your mechanic for recommendations.
